Surface area = 400 ft²

Volume = 448 ft³

Step-by-step explanation:

length = 4 ft

width = 8 ft

height = 14 ft

The storage chest is a rectangular prism in shape

We use volume of rectangular prism formula:


\text{Volume of rectangular prism = length }* width\text{ }*\text{ height}
\begin{gathered} \text{Volume = 4ft }*\text{ 8ft }*\text{ 14 ft} \\ \text{Volume = }448ft^3 \end{gathered}

Hence, the volume of the storage chest is 448ft³

Surface area of rectangular prism = 2(lw + hw + hl)

Surface area = 2(4 × 8 + 14 × 8 + 14 × 4)

Surface area = 2(32 + 112 + 56)

Surface area = 2(200)

Surface area = 400 ft²

Surface area of the chest = 400 ft²
